NCF Postpones Zonal U-17 Playoffs
The earlier fixed date for the South- South Girls and Boys Zonal National Under-17 Cricket Playoffs to be hosted by Rivers State, at the University of Port Harcourt (UNIPORT) Choba, Cricket pitch has been postponed
This was disclosed yesterday by the National Development Manager for the Southern Region, Tonye Timinadi.
The earlier scheduled date which was 7-31 January is now shifted to 15-17 January, 2021 for Girls zonal qualification and the Girls final is fixed for 29-31 January.
While, 21-24 of this month has been picked for the Boys Zonal qualification and 4-7 February, 2021 for the Boys final.
According to Timinadi who is also head coach Rivers State Cricket association, the postponement of the National Under 17 Cricket Championship was to enable the Federation put all necessary modalities in place.
Also, to ensure that the competition is up to the expected standard and organized, inline with all guidelines of COVID-19.
He said that the Nigeria Cricket Federation (NCF) regrets any inconveniences the postponement of the playoffs dates may have caused.
He however, urged participants to be focused and be more committed to their chosen career as they prepare for the task ahead.
